Recently, the cryptocurrency market has experienced a significant decline, mainly due to threefold pressure: #全球科技股抛售冲击风险资产
Macroeconomic expectations have shifted: The Federal Reserve has paused interest rate cuts, and the new chairman's nomination leans towards a 'hawkish' stance, leading to a disappointment in market expectations for liquidity easing.
Concentration of leveraged liquidations: High-leverage long positions have been liquidated in a chain reaction during the decline, causing a stampede and amplifying the drop.
Reassessment of asset attributes: The narrative of Bitcoin as 'digital gold' and 'tech leverage' has weakened, with a diminished correlation to gold and the Nasdaq, resulting in a rapid withdrawal of funds.
The combination of these three factors has led the market to retract over 50% from its highs, with sentiment entering 'extreme fear.' Recovery will require clarity in policy and the clearing of leverage. $BTC
